BEng (Hons) Software Engineering with Foundation Year - 36 months
Unlocking the Potential of Software Engineering: A Comprehensive Guide Through our BEng (Hons) Software Engineering with Foundation Year Program Enriched in a Whitepaper
BEng (Hons) Software Engineering with Foundation Year - 36 Months
In today’s fast-paced digital world, software engineering has become one of the most sought-after fields. The BEng (Hons) Software Engineering with Foundation Year - 36 Months is a comprehensive program designed to equip students with the technical skills, theoretical knowledge, and practical experience needed to excel in this dynamic industry. This article delves into the key aspects of the course, its benefits, and the career opportunities it opens up.
Why Choose BEng (Hons) Software Engineering with Foundation Year?
The foundation year is an excellent opportunity for students who may not meet the direct entry requirements for a degree in software engineering. It provides a solid grounding in essential subjects such as mathematics, programming, and computer science fundamentals. Here are some compelling reasons to consider this program:
- Strong Foundation: The foundation year ensures students are well-prepared for the rigorous demands of the degree program.
- Industry-Relevant Curriculum: The course is designed in collaboration with industry experts to ensure graduates are job-ready.
- Hands-On Experience: Students gain practical experience through projects, internships, and lab work.
- Career Opportunities: Graduates are highly sought after in industries such as software development, cybersecurity, and artificial intelligence.
Course Structure and Key Modules
The 36-month program is divided into three stages: the foundation year, the intermediate stage, and the final year. Below is a breakdown of the key modules covered in each stage:
Stage
Key Modules
Foundation Year
- Introduction to Programming
- Mathematics for Computing
- Computer Systems Fundamentals
- Academic Skills for Computing
Intermediate Stage
- Object-Oriented Programming
- Data Structures and Algorithms
- Web Development
- Database Systems
Final Year
- Software Engineering Principles
- Artificial Intelligence
- Cybersecurity
- Capstone Project
Career Prospects and Industry Demand
Graduates of the BEng (Hons) Software Engineering program are well-positioned to pursue a
- Introduction to Programming
- Mathematics for Computing
- Computer Systems Fundamentals
- Academic Skills for Computing
- Object-Oriented Programming
- Data Structures and Algorithms
- Web Development
- Database Systems
- Software Engineering Principles
- Artificial Intelligence
- Cybersecurity
- Capstone Project